[SOLVED] Lock Screen too rebellious. it skips the settings.

The lock screen appears every 5 minutes of inactivity and I must continue setting the password. I do not understand why this happens, because I have configured, "Suspend the session after" set to 360 minutes.

You're looking at the wrong settings, lock screen is configured via Desktop Behaviour > Screen Locking.
